Output 39918becc70cc95a9425310d3bfcf3bd587c498ec9d19113bc998d8460936474:0

value
668541368
script pubkey
OP_0 OP_PUSHBYTES_20 728809abd2412fd28642bf257e4a058f0bcc2706
address
bc1qw2yqn27jgyha9pjzhujhujs93u9ucfcxl7699y
transaction
39918becc70cc95a9425310d3bfcf3bd587c498ec9d19113bc998d8460936474
spent
true